About Robina 4226

The size of Robina is approximately 15.3 square kilometres. It has 38 parks covering nearly 25.6% of total area. The population of Robina in 2011 was 20,522 people. By 2016 the population was 23,090 showing a population growth of 12.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Robina is 20-29 years. Households in Robina are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Robina work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 63.9% of the homes in Robina were owner-occupied compared with 62.3% in 2016.

Robina has 11,517 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Robina have seen a 93.97%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 72.17%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Robina is $1,359,726 while the median value for Units is $764,402.
  • Houses have a median rent of $890 while Units have a median rent of $750.
